Arkansas Code § 12-18-904

Child Maltreatment Central Registry generally

An offender's name shall remain in the Child Maltreatment Central Registry unless: (1) The name is removed pursuant to this chapter or another statute; (2) The name is removed under a rule; (3) The name was provisionally placed in the registry and the alleged offender subsequently prevails at an administrative hearing; or (4) The offender prevails upon appeal. Acts 2009, No. 749, § 1.
